Details of C 14/35/A53
Reference: C 14/35/A53
Description:

Cause number: 1843 A53.

Short title: Ash v Carter.

Documents: Bill only.

Plaintiffs: Caroline Ash wife of Revd John George Ash by Thomas William Bowlby her next friend.

Defendants: William Jarrott Carter, William Whisfield, William Selby Hele, Mary Ann Hele his wife, John George Ash, Emma Felicia Selby Hele, Jane Eliza Selby Hele, Marion Selby Hele, Agnes Felicia Selby Hele, Sara Maria Selby Hele, Elizabeth Henrietta Selby Hele, Henry Horne Selby Hele, William Downes Selby Hele, John Hewett, Felicia Hewett, John George Hele Ash, Richard Robert Drummond Ash, Caroline Sarah Felicia Ash, Matilda Isabel Ash, Jane Maria Marian Ash, Selby Attree Horne Ash and Robert Halcott Paul Ash.

Note: Details have been added from C 32/1, which also gives information about further process.
Date: 1843
